HOPING to show that being healthy can also be fun, Oxleas NHS Trust is to host its second Health Festival.

The free festival will take place at Charlton Athletic FC’s ground in Floyd Road, Charlton, on May 27 from 10am until 3pm There will be lots of craft and market stalls and activities, including the chance to play football and have a go at less familiar sports such as fencing and volleyball.

People will also be able to get a health or BMI check, advice on diet and healthy living, as well as information about jobs, housing and education.
